2012-05-11 16 views
0

電子メールの送信に使用しているサーバーの電子メールサイズ制限を確認する方法はありますか?あなたが送っているものをチェックする方法があるとは思っていませんが(それについて聞いてみたいと思う方法があれば)。私はあなたが使用しているサーバーに依存する可能性があると推測しているので、私は要点を得ることができるように、Google Apps/Gmailサーバーを特に求めます。その他のポインターは、ご了承ください:)JavaMail API:サーバーのサイズ制限を確認する

答えて

1

SMTPを使用すると、サーバーは許容される最大メッセージサイズをレポートできます。すべてのサーバーではありません。 This threadに詳細があります。

2

私の経験から - いいえ。すべてのサーバーには独自の制限があり、JavaMail APIを使用して自動的に検出する方法はありません。

私の回避策:マップサーバーを作成します。プロパティファイルを制限し、ユーザーからメールを送信するときに使用します。すべてのサーバーにアクセスし、サイトから定義することができます。マップにサーバーが見つからない場合、私はデフォルトの制限を使用します。

制限控除についての標準通知もありませんでした。 Exceadの限界を超えてファイルを送信するとき、例外を意味します。

関連する問題